MOON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review

40 of the 6,341 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Direxion Moonshot Innovators ETF (MOON)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$11M — down 34% from $16.5M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 9 funds closed out of MOON and 5 opened new positions — a net loss of 4 holders — while 12 trimmed existing stakes and 13 added.

The largest buyer was Brookstone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$653K. The largest seller was Citadel Advisors, exiting entirely with an estimated $638K sold.
